高级语言程序设计与应用教程

高级语言程序设计与应用教程 pdf epub mobi txt 电子书 下载 2026

出版者:清华大学
作者:陈静
出品人:
页数:310
译者:
出版时间:2008-1
价格:29.00元
装帧:
isbn号码:9787302167334
丛书系列:
图书标签:
  • 教材
  • 大学
  • 中文
  • C语言
  • 程序设计
  • 高级语言
  • 教程
  • 应用
  • 计算机
  • 编程
  • 教材
  • 学习
  • 基础
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《高等学校教材•计算机应用•高级语言程序设计与应用教程》分未基础篇和实践篇,在基础篇中对C语言程序设计基础及算法的概念进行了概述,对基本数据类型,运算符与表达式等进行了介绍和分析,并加入了面向对象的程序设计的相关知识,在实践篇中介绍了常用C语言的开发环境以及如何进行C语言中的基本数据类型,程序涉及控制结构,数组等。

好的,以下是一份为您量身定制的、不包含《高级语言程序设计与应用教程》内容的图书简介,力求详尽且自然流畅: --- 图书简介:《数据之海的航行者:现代信息架构与高效能计算实践》 一、 导论:信息洪流中的定向与赋能 我们正身处于一个由数据驱动的时代,信息的广度与深度以前所未有的速度增长。传统的信息处理范式在应对海量、异构、高并发的数据流时,已显露出其局限性。本书并非聚焦于某一特定编程语言的语法或基础结构,而是将视角提升至信息系统架构的宏观层面,探讨如何构建健壮、可扩展且性能卓越的现代计算基础设施。 本书的核心目标是培养读者从系统层面思考问题的能力,理解支撑当前数字世界运行的底层逻辑与设计哲学。我们深入剖析数据如何在不同层次的存储介质、处理引擎与网络拓扑间高效流转,旨在将读者塑造成能够驾驭复杂信息环境的“架构师”而非仅仅是“编码员”。 二、 核心篇章:分布式系统的基石与挑战 1. 现代存储范式的深度解析: 本篇详细梳理了从传统关系型数据库(RDBMS)到NoSQL数据库的演进脉络。我们不满足于介绍API调用,而是深入研究CAP原理在不同存储选型中的权衡,并对比分析ACID与BASE模型在实际业务场景中的适用性。章节内容涵盖了键值存储(如Redis的内部结构与持久化机制)、文档数据库(MongoDB的聚合管道与索引优化)、列式存储(Cassandra或HBase的设计哲学)以及图数据库(Neo4j的遍历算法与应用场景)。重点在于理解不同存储模型背后的数据模型设计思想,以及如何针对特定的读写模式进行存储选型与性能调优。 2. 并发控制与事务处理的艺术: 并发是现代系统的固有属性。本章聚焦于操作系统层面和应用层面的并发控制技术。我们将探讨多线程模型(如Actor模型、CSP模型)与传统锁机制(如Mutex、Semaphore)的优缺点。在数据库事务方面,本书详尽阐述了MVCC(多版本并发控制)的实现原理,并分析了悲观锁与乐观锁在分布式事务协调中的应用,特别是Two-Phase Commit (2PC) 和 Three-Phase Commit (3PC) 的局限性,以及Paxos/Raft等共识算法如何在无主或多主架构中保证数据一致性。 三、 高效能计算的引擎:并行化与加速 1. 批处理与流处理的统一视角: 大数据处理的两个主流范式——批处理(如MapReduce的深层原理)与实时流处理(如Kafka Streams或Flink的事件时间语义)——在本章得到综合论述。我们关注的重点在于数据管道(Data Pipeline)的设计,包括数据清洗、转换与加载(ETL/ELT)策略,以及如何选择合适的资源调度器(如YARN)来优化资源隔离与任务优先级。对于流处理,我们将重点剖析窗口函数(Windowing)的类型(滑动、滚动、会话)及其在状态管理中的作用。 2. GPU与异构计算的潜力挖掘: 为应对深度学习和高性能科学计算的需求,异构计算已成为主流。本章不侧重于CUDA编程,而是从计算模型的角度审视CPU、GPU、FPGA等不同处理器之间的协同工作方式。我们讨论数据传输瓶颈的识别与规避,以及如何利用成熟的计算框架(如TensorFlow或PyTorch的底层优化策略)来最大化并行度。目标是理解如何在多核乃至众核架构上有效地分解计算任务。 四、 网络架构与系统可靠性 1. 现代网络协议栈的优化: 从TCP/IP到HTTP/2乃至HTTP/3(QUIC),网络通信协议的演进直接影响着系统性能。本书详细解析了拥塞控制算法(如BBR)对高延迟网络的影响,并探讨了在微服务架构中,如何利用服务网格(Service Mesh)来统一管理服务间的通信、流量控制与安全策略,而无需修改应用代码。 2. 弹性、可观测性与故障注入: 构建一个能“自愈”的系统至关重要。本篇强调高可用性(HA)的设计原则,包括负载均衡的策略选择(L4/L7)与健康检查机制。我们深入探讨可观测性(Observability)的三大支柱——指标(Metrics)、日志(Logs)和追踪(Tracing)——如何协同工作,以实现对复杂分布式系统内部状态的实时洞察。此外,我们介绍混沌工程(Chaos Engineering)的实践,通过主动引入故障来验证系统的韧性。 五、 结论:面向未来的架构思维 本书的终点并非知识的穷尽,而是思维模式的转变。掌握了数据、并发、网络与计算加速的底层逻辑后,读者将能够基于业务需求,而非工具限制,去设计出前瞻性的、具备高度适应性的信息系统解决方案。这要求我们始终关注新的硬件发展趋势和计算范式的迭代,成为一个持续学习和构建的实践者。 ---

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

王明安

评分

王明安

评分

王明安

评分

王明安

评分

王明安

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有